In today's digital age, the use of cryptocurrencies has become increasingly popular. Bitcoin, being the first and most well-known cryptocurrency, has a vast user base. One common question among Bitcoin users is whether they can access their Bitcoin wallet on multiple devices. The answer is yes, you can access your Bitcoin wallet on multiple devices, but there are certain factors to consider.
Firstly, it's essential to understand that a Bitcoin wallet is a digital storage solution that holds your private and public keys. These keys are crucial for sending and receiving Bitcoin transactions. There are various types of Bitcoin wallets, including software wallets, hardware wallets, and web wallets. Each type has its unique features and capabilities.
Software wallets are applications that you can install on your computer, smartphone, or tablet. They are convenient for everyday use, but they may not offer the highest level of security. Some popular software wallets include Electrum, Bitcoin Core, and Mycelium.
Hardware wallets, on the other hand, are physical devices designed specifically for storing cryptocurrencies. They provide a higher level of security compared to software wallets, as they store your private keys offline. Examples of hardware wallets include Ledger Nano S, Trezor, and CoolBitX.
Web wallets are online services that allow you to access your Bitcoin wallet from any device with an internet connection. They are convenient for users who want to access their wallet from multiple devices, but they may be more susceptible to hacking and other online threats.
Now, let's address the question: Can I access my Bitcoin wallet on multiple devices? The answer is yes, you can. Here's how:
1. Software wallets: If you're using a software wallet, you can install it on multiple devices. However, you'll need to ensure that you have the same private and public keys on all devices. This can be achieved by syncing your wallet across devices using cloud services or by manually copying the keys.
2. Hardware wallets: Hardware wallets are designed to be used on a single device. However, you can still access your Bitcoin wallet on multiple devices by using a web interface or a companion app. These apps allow you to manage your hardware wallet's contents and perform transactions from any device with an internet connection.
3. Web wallets: Web wallets are the most convenient option for accessing your Bitcoin wallet on multiple devices. You can simply log in to your web wallet account from any device with an internet connection. Ensure that you use a strong password and enable two-factor authentication for enhanced security.
When accessing your Bitcoin wallet on multiple devices, it's crucial to consider the following:
1. Security: Always keep your private keys safe and secure. Avoid sharing them with others and use a secure password for your wallet. If you're using a web wallet, ensure that the service is reputable and has robust security measures in place.
2. Syncing: If you're using a software wallet, make sure to sync your wallet across devices regularly. This will ensure that you have the latest transaction history and balance information.
3. Backup: Create backups of your wallet's private and public keys. Store them in a safe and secure location, such as an external hard drive or a USB flash drive. This will help you recover your wallet in case of device loss or damage.
In conclusion, you can access your Bitcoin wallet on multiple devices, whether you're using a software wallet, hardware wallet, or web wallet. However, it's essential to prioritize security, sync your wallet regularly, and create backups to ensure the safety of your Bitcoin holdings.
